ABORIGINAL HERITAGE ACT 1988 - SECT 6

6—Delegation

        (1)         The Minister may delegate any of the Minister's powers or functions under this Act other than the power to authorise the commencement of proceedings for an offence against this Act.

        (2)         The Minister must, at the request of the traditional owners of an Aboriginal site or object, delegate the Minister's powers under sections 21, 23, 29 and 35 to the traditional owners of the site or object.

        (3)         A delegation under this section—

            (a)         must be in writing; and

            (b)         may be subject to such conditions as the Minister considers appropriate; and

            (c)         may authorise the sub-delegation of a specified power; and

            (d)         if made to the holder of a specified office or position, empowers any person holding or acting in the office or position to exercise the delegated powers; and

            (e)         is revocable at will; and

            (f)         does not prevent the Minister from acting personally in any matter.

        (4)         The Minister must not revoke a delegation under subsection (2) without the consent of the traditional owners.
